首页 > 资讯 > 严选问答 >

搭建ftp服务端

2026-01-12 05:12:19
最佳答案

搭建ftp服务端】在企业或个人服务器中,FTP(文件传输协议)是实现文件上传、下载和管理的重要工具。搭建一个稳定、安全的FTP服务端,能够有效提升数据交互效率,保障信息的安全性。以下是对搭建FTP服务端的总结与操作流程。

一、搭建FTP服务端的核心步骤

步骤 操作内容 说明
1 选择FTP服务软件 常用如 vsftpd、ProFTPD、FileZilla Server 等,根据需求选择合适的软件
2 安装FTP服务端软件 根据操作系统安装对应的软件包,如 Linux 下使用 `apt` 或 `yum` 安装
3 配置FTP服务配置文件 修改配置文件以设置用户权限、访问路径、登录方式等
4 创建FTP用户 添加系统用户或虚拟用户,确保用户有访问权限
5 设置防火墙规则 开放21端口(默认FTP端口),防止外部访问被阻断
6 测试FTP连接 使用客户端工具(如 FileZilla、命令行 `ftp`)测试连接是否成功
7 启动并设置开机自启 确保服务正常运行,并设置为开机自动启动

二、常见FTP服务端软件对比

软件名称 优点 缺点 适用场景
vsftpd 高安全性,配置简单 功能相对基础 企业级小型FTP服务
ProFTPD 支持模块化扩展 配置复杂 复杂网络环境
FileZilla Server 图形界面友好,支持Windows 资源占用较高 个人或小型团队使用
Pure-FTPd 轻量级,支持SSL/TLS 功能较少 快速部署轻量级服务

三、注意事项

1. 安全性:建议使用SSL/TLS加密传输,避免明文密码泄露。

2. 权限控制:合理分配用户权限,防止越权访问。

3. 日志记录:开启日志功能,便于排查问题和审计操作。

4. 定期备份:对配置文件和用户数据进行备份,防止意外丢失。

5. 更新维护:定期检查软件版本,及时修补漏洞。

四、总结

搭建FTP服务端是一项基础但关键的运维工作,它直接影响到数据的传输效率和系统的安全性。通过合理的配置和管理,可以构建一个高效、稳定的FTP服务环境。无论是企业还是个人用户,掌握FTP服务的搭建方法都具有实际意义。

关键词:FTP服务端、搭建、vsftpd、配置、安全、用户权限

免责声明:本答案或内容为用户上传,不代表本网观点。其原创性以及文中陈述文字和内容未经本站证实,对本文以及其中全部或者部分内容、文字的真实性、完整性、及时性本站不作任何保证或承诺,请读者仅作参考,并请自行核实相关内容。 如遇侵权请及时联系本站删除。